Understanding the M240's Rate of Fire

The M240 machine gun is designed to deliver a sustained and controllable rate of fire, making it an invaluable asset on the battlefield. Its rate of fire refers to the number of rounds it can fire per minute, and it plays a crucial role in its effectiveness as a support weapon.

Cyclic Rate of Fire

The M240 boasts an impressive cyclic rate of fire, which is the maximum number of rounds it can theoretically fire in an ideal condition. This rate is typically measured in rounds per minute (RPM) and is an essential specification to consider when evaluating the gun's performance.

The cyclic rate of fire for the M240 is approximately 650 to 1,000 RPM, depending on the specific variant and the type of ammunition used. This range provides a versatile and adaptable firing capability, allowing the gun to be used in various scenarios.
